Overview

A meditation on grief, self-discovery, survival, love, and love again, QUEERHEDONIA traces the raw edges of loss and the slow stitching of a self remade. These poems dwell in devotion and departure alike-where blueprints are never the final design-finding tenderness in unexpected places and joy in the very act of enduring. With fierce lyricism and intimate storytelling, each poem strikes a reverent chord, carrying the radiant hum of queerness in every word.

Author Information

Kris Nicholas Conrad (he/him) has filled many notebooks, napkins, bound journals, sticky notes, used envelopes, and phone apps with lots and lots of lines, many of which will hopefully never see the light of day. In college, he won the Nemet Scholarship for Excellence in Creative Writing twice. In the present day, Nick is honored to have placed his debut chapbook with Arcana. His poems explore themes of memory, anxiety, community, existing queerly on a quirky planet, healing, recovery, and self-discovery. Nick has published individual poems in several zines and other publications, including the Massachusetts Bards Poetry Anthology 2025, and he reads at poetry events throughout southeastern New England. Nick lives in Eastern Massachusetts with his artist/musician/fix-anything partner and their canine copilot.
